#4a8f02 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4a8f02 is composed of 29% red, 56.1% green and 0.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 98.6% yellow and 43.9% black. It has a hue angle of 89.4 degrees, a saturation of 97.2% and a lightness of 28.4%. #4a8f02 color hex could be obtained by blending #94ff04 with #001f00. Closest websafe color is: #339900.

#4a8f02 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4a8f02 has RGB values of R:74, G:143, B:2 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0, Y:0.99,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 4886274.

Shades and Tints of #4a8f02
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040800 is the darkest color, while #f9fff3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#4a8f02
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#494c45 is the less saturated color, while #4a8f02 is the most saturated one.
